FAQs
Q1: What is PVDF Powder and what is it used for?
PVDF Powder (Polyvinylidene Fluoride Powder) is a high-performance fluoropolymer known for its excellent chemical resistance, thermal stability, mechanical strength, and electrical insulation properties. It is widely used in chemical processing equipment, lithium-ion batteries, coatings, membranes, wire insulation, and industrial components where durability and reliability are required.
Q2: What are the key properties of PVDF Powder?
PVDF Powder offers a unique combination of high purity, outstanding resistance to acids and solvents, UV stability, flame retardancy, and long service life. It also exhibits good piezoelectric and dielectric properties, making it suitable for advanced electronic, energy storage, and membrane applications.
Q3: Is PVDF Powder suitable for lithium-ion battery applications?
Yes, PVDF Powder is commonly used as a binder material in lithium-ion battery electrodes. Its strong adhesion, chemical stability, and electrochemical compatibility help improve battery performance, cycle life, and structural integrity, making it a preferred choice in energy storage systems.
